ACCOMMODATION

Sliding double glazed patio door leads into;

ENTRANCE PORCH 2.49m x 1.12m 8 2" x 3 8"

Double glazed windows overlooking the front and side of the property. Tiled floor. Double glazed front door leads into;

HALLWAY

Stairs with turned bannisters rising to the first floor. Useful understairs cupboard. Plate racks. Door to integral Garage. Central heating radiator. Doors to;

LIVING ROOM 5.48m x 4.26m Max 17 11" x 13 11"

Coved ceiling. Dual aspect double glazed windows to the front and side of the property. Window seat. Split stone fireplace with fitted living flame effect gas fire and raised places for audio and hi fi equipment. Two central heating radiators. TV lead. Daido rail.

KITCHEN DINING ROOM 7.03m x 3.04m 23 0" x 9 11"

Coved ceiling. Double glazed windows and french doors looking out over and leading to the rear gardens. Range of wall and floor mounted units with rolled edge work surfaces and tiled splashbacks. Integrated oven and hob with cooker hood over. Single drainer stainless steel sink with mixer tap over. Integrated dishwasher and under counter fridge. Pantry cupboard. Central heating radiator. Tiled floor. Multi paned glazed door to;

REAR HALLWAY

Double glazed door out to the rear gardens. Tiled floor. Door into;

WETROOM 2.92m x 0.88m 9 6" x 2 10"

Fully tiled wet room with graded, non slip floor and fitted electric shower and shower seat. Double glazed window to the rear of the property. Grab rail. Extractor. Central heating radiator.

CLOAKROOM 1.42m x 0.84m 4 7" x 2 9"

Recessed wash hand basin. Low level WC. Window.

BEDROOM 2.86m x 2.39m 9 4" x 7 10"

Double glazed window looking out over gardens towards Higher Preston in the distance. Central heating radiator.

FIRST FLOOR LANDING

Double glazed window to the rear of the property. Access to lost space. Access to useful undereaves storage. Airing cupboard with factory lagged cylinder and shelving for linens. Central heating radiator. Smoke alarm. Doors to;

BEDROOM 4.12m Max into wardrobe x 2.79m 13 6" x 9 1"

Double glazed window overlooking the side of the property and out across rooftops to the sea with Torquay in the distance. Central heating radiator. Built in wardrobe. Sliding mirror door fronted wardrobe units.

BEDROOM 3.96m x 3.7m 12 11" x 12 1"

Double glazed window overlooking the front of the property. Central heating radiator. Built in wardrobe.

BEDROOM 3.86m x 2.97m plus door recess 12 7" x 9 8"

Double glazed window overlooking the side of the property. Central heating radiator. Built in wardrobe.

BATHROOM 3.1m x 1.52m 10 2" x 4 11"

Two obscure double glazed windows to the rear of the property. Suite comprising pedestal wash hand basin, bath with mixer shower tap and low level WC. Central heating radiator. Medicine cabinet. Tiled walls.

OUTSIDE

Turning off St Andrews Road there is a long sweeping driveway for numbers 19 and 21 with ample parking available to the left hand side. This leads to a driveway in front of the garage for Number 19. The front gardens are laid to level lawns with dwarf walling , established trees, bushes and flower borders. Pathways lead around either side of the property. To the rear there is a good sized patio entertaining area with wooden balustrading this leads out onto level lawned gardens. To the other side there are gardens with further lawn area and what was a formerly productive vegetable plot with the remains of a greenhouse.

INTEGRAL GARAGE 5.19m x 2.88m 17 0" x 9 5"

Roller garage door. Double obscure glazed window to the side of the property. Wall mounted boiler. Meters. Door to Hallway.

AGENTS NOTES

Freehold. Council Tax Band E. Garage and Driveway. Mains gas, electricity, water and sewerage. Rainwater goes to a soak away. Neighbours have access across the main drive leading up from the road to numbers 19 & 21. Openreach says there is fibre broadband in the street.
